HYDERABAD: Six persons were arrested from a residence at Ranigunj in Secunderabad on Thursday and a country-made pistol and three live rounds were recovered. The police busted the gang, which was looking around for a prospective buyer of the firearm.


Among the accused was an auto driver from Pune, 18-year-old Hussain Gyas Mohammed Khan, who had procured the pistol and ammunition from Bihar three months ago. He came in touch with his childhood friend from Mallapur, P Prakash, to dispose of the firearm with a promise to offer him a good commission if the pistol gets sold.


Prakash, who brought the pistol from Pune, contacted his friends - J Mohan of Rajendra Nagar, Nemi Chand and Ganpat Jatti of Secunderabad and Narender Chowdary of Vikarabad - to search for customers. The pistol was kept at Nemi's house in Ranigunj, while the gang looked out for prospective buyers.


Hussain came down to Hyderabad on Thursday and met Nemi and others at his house to discuss ways to sell the weapon. On credible information, a west zone Task Force team raided the house and arrested the six accused persons.
